The Apostle Peter is the great example of a true confessor of Jesus Christ. In Matthew 16:16, in answer to Jesus' question to his disciples as to who people were saying he was, Peter declared, "You are the Christ, the Son of the living God." 
On another occasion in John 6, after many of the followers of Jesus were deserting him, Jesus asked his disciples if they, too, would leave him. Peter answered, "Lord, to whom shall be go? You have the words of eternal life, and we have believed, and come to know that you are the Holy One of God" (John 6:69).
This bold declaration and confession of Jesus as the Christ, the Son of God, marked Peter's preaching  as he led the early church in the same confession of Jesus . 
Peter's untiring confession of the Lordship of Christ led to his own martyrdom. Likewise many true confessors of Jesus are suffering for their loyalty to declare the truth today. 
In a world in desperate need of hearing the Gospel, may we likewise not be hesitant to declare and confess that "Jesus is the Christ, the Son of the living God."
